Whilst it can be difficult to find suitable tank mates for oscars providing a healthy diet is not. They re omnivores and will eat pretty much anything you give them. In the wild they would eat small fish larvae and small pieces of plant debris. Small insects and crustaceans would make up the largest part of their diet. Feeding baby oscar fish.
Juvenile oscars will eat more than adult oscars and the frequent small feedings absolutely applies to young oscars. Nor should the skip feeding process be practiced on juvenile oscars they need food several times a day each day. Grown oscars eat much less frequently than do juvenile oscars.
